Space Saver Design

In the event that bad weather or costly gym memberships are keeping you from exercising regularly having a treadmill at home makes it easier to maintain your fitness. The treadmills of today are compact and easy to store, making them an excellent supplement to any home workout routine.

There are a variety of factors to take into consideration when selecting a compact home treadmill. In the first place you'll need to think about the frequency you intend to use the machine. If you're just beginning to get back into the gym and intend to power walk or light jog an affordable folding treadmill might be sufficient for you. If you're a runner and want to train for road races and marathons, then you should look for treadmills that have more advanced features that can handle the demands of a heavier workload.

The LifeSpan Fitness TR1200-DT3 underneath desk treadmill near me is a great option for those who just require a little movement during work. This treadmill is designed to allow you to work and walk simultaneously. It can be easily rolled under your desk.

There are a variety of options when you're looking for a treadmill which can be folded flat and stored under your bed or in your closet. But, you should be aware that these treadmills typically have a smaller deck and are less functional than those that are upright. They are also lighter and more unstable, particularly when you run on them.

Another thing to consider is how much horsepower the motor has, particularly if you're planning to run regularly. The majority of treadmills that fold can only support a moderate speed. However, more powerful machines are capable of higher speeds and even incline running. Make sure you choose a console with clear, easy-to-read information, including the distance traveled and calories burnt. Some of the most expensive treadmills come with features such as Bluetooth connectivity with a touchscreen as well as 30 pre-programmed workouts.

There are a variety of treadmills available for sale in the $500-$1,000 price range. Treadmills in this price range usually have top speeds of 8 or 10 miles per hour (MPH), which is equivalent to a 7:30 mile or 15:30 5K run. They also have lower motor ratings, typically 2.2 continuous horsepower or less.

As you advance in the price range, speed and horsepower go up too. There are treadmills for sale for as little as $2,000 that are able to reach 12 MPH, which is enough for runners to easily complete 5 minutes of running or a 10-minute 5K. You'll see treadmills that have higher incline options, some with up to 15% of incline and others with the ability to decrease.

Another important consideration is the amount of horsepower that the motor delivers. It will affect how smooth and powerful the machine feels. A higher-end treadmill may feature motors that can deliver up to 3.0 continuous-duty horsepower. The size of the belt also plays a part. It determines how comfortable the treadmill feels to run or walk on, as well as how long it is able to comfortably support your weight.

Some treadmills have LCD or LED screens too. The former tends to be more popular, but it isn't always easy to see in certain lighting conditions, particularly if you exercise in the dark. The latter is more expensive, and has a a brighter screen that is more easy to read.

Some treadmills are made for walking, whereas others are designed for running. These treadmills have a smaller deck with lower weight capacities and fewer console features. These treadmills can provide a an excellent walking or jogging exercise but they're not as advanced as the running models.
